Not a safe choice. Not trying to be. Sweet Taboo is for the hour when rules soften, when the spice on your wrist is the only chaperone. Cardamom, cinnamon, cocoa, coffee. It earns its name.Sweet Taboo
Some fragrances suggest. Tobacco Vanille insists. The tobacco-vanilla-cocoa trifecta is executed so well here that it borders on addictive, sweet enough to comfort, strong enough to announce.Tobacco Vanille
